Refresh Your Space With a Spring Clean

Spring cleaning doesn’t have to be overwhelming—think of it as a way to clear out stagnant energy and create space for new beginnings.
Focus on These Key Areas:
- Declutter With Intention: Start by sorting through winter items like heavy blankets and holiday décor. Store what you’ll need next year and donate anything you no longer use.
- Let the Light In: Wash windows, dust light fixtures, and swap heavy curtains for lighter fabrics to invite more natural light into your home.
- Freshen Up Linens: Launder throw pillows, blankets, and bedding to remove winter’s coziness and replace them with breezy, breathable fabrics like cotton or linen.
- Air Out Your Home: On mild days, open windows to let fresh air flow through your space, clearing out any stuffiness from winter.
Embrace Nature With Seasonal Decor

Spring is a season of renewal and growth, so look to nature for inspiration when decorating your home.
Simple Ways to Add Spring Touches:

- Bring in Fresh Flowers and Greenery: A vase of tulips, daffodils, or freshly cut branches can instantly brighten a room. Houseplants like ferns or peace lilies also add life and improve air quality.
- Use Light and Airy Colors: Incorporate soft pastels, earthy greens, and warm neutrals into your décor through throw pillows, blankets, and decorative accents.
- Decorate With Natural Elements: Display bowls of fresh fruit, woven baskets, and wooden décor items to reflect the beauty of the season.
- Create a Seasonal Centerpiece: Arrange fresh flowers, candles, and natural elements like moss or stones on your dining table or coffee table.
Simplify Your Home Routine for the Season

Spring is a time to embrace a slower, more intentional way of living. Simplify your daily routines to create a sense of ease and harmony.
Spring Homemaking Habits:
- Switch to Lighter Meals: As seasonal produce like leafy greens, berries, and asparagus becomes available, lighten up your meal plan with fresh, vibrant recipes.
- Refresh Your Cleaning Routine: Adjust your cleaning schedule to focus on maintenance rather than deep cleaning. A few minutes of daily tidying can keep your home feeling fresh without becoming overwhelming.
- Declutter Your Kitchen: Clear out expired pantry items and organize your kitchen to make space for seasonal ingredients.
- Create a Cozy Outdoor Space: As the weather warms, set up a cozy spot on your porch, balcony, or backyard where you can relax and enjoy the fresh air.
Bring the Outdoors In With Natural Scents

The scents of spring—fresh rain, blooming flowers, and green grass—can uplift your mood and create a welcoming atmosphere.
Ways to Add Natural Scents to Your Home:
- Use Essential Oils: Diffuse spring-inspired essential oils like lavender, lemon, peppermint, or eucalyptus.
- Simmer Potpourri on the Stove: Simmer a pot of water with citrus slices, fresh herbs, and a cinnamon stick for a natural, refreshing scent.
- Open Your Windows: Let the fresh air carry the natural scents of spring into your home.
Celebrate the Season With Simple Traditions

Spring is a season of growth, renewal, and connection. Create small, meaningful traditions that help you and your family embrace the season’s beauty.
Spring Traditions to Try:
- Plant a Small Garden: Whether it’s a windowsill herb garden or a few flower pots on your porch, gardening is a rewarding way to connect with nature.
- Enjoy Outdoor Meals: As the weather warms, have breakfast on the porch or host a picnic in your backyard.
- Take Nature Walks: Explore local parks and trails, noticing the blooming flowers, budding trees, and returning birds.
- Celebrate Spring Holidays: Whether it’s Ostara, Easter, or simply the arrival of spring, mark the season with a special meal, nature-themed crafts, or a family outing.
